Resume for a Carpenter in Palmerston North

Carpentry is a highly-specialized job that requires precision, focus on detail, and years of expertise. A well-designed resume can aid carpenters to showcase their talents and get a job that is rewarding. In this article, we will guide you through the steps to create an professional resume for a carpenter.

1. Personal Information

Contact Details

Begin your resume by including your full name, phone number email address. Make sure these details are up-to-date and easily accessible.

Objective Statement

Create a short objective statement which outlines your career goals as a carpenter. You can tailor it to the particular position or industry that you’re applying to.

Example: Highly skilled carpenter with over 10 years of experience, looking to make use of my woodworking skills in a thriving construction company.

2. Professional Summary

This section should you should summarize your experiences as a carpenter. You should also highlight any particular skills or accomplishments which make you stand above other applicants.

Example: A versatile and detail-oriented carpenter with a proven track record of delivering quality craftsmanship in both residential and commercial projects. Highly skilled in all woodworking techniques, including cabinetry, framing and finish work. A strong problem-solving ability coupled with exceptional communication skills allows me to work effectively both on my own and as part of a team.

3. Skills

The key skills you need to master are applicable to the field of carpentry. Include skills that are technical, such as:

  • Proficiency in using hand devices and power tools
  • A working knowledge of various woodworking techniques
  • Ability to read blueprints and interpret the design plans
  • Expertise in cutting, measuring, and shaping wood materials
  • Understanding of safety procedures and rules in carpentry

Remember to mention any specialized capabilities or qualifications you hold that set you apart from other applicants.

4. Work Experience

Incorporate your prior work experience in the field of carpentry with a focus on your primary tasks and accomplishments. Include the name of the company the name of your job, dates of employment, and a brief description of your duties.

Example:

Carpenter – ABC Construction Company | January 2015 – Present

  • Custom cabinets constructed and installed for residential clients and designers, working closely to bring their ideas to life.
  • Successfully completed multiple remodeling projects within specified timeframes and still maintained the highest quality standards.
  • Collaboration with other tradespeople at building sites in order to guarantee smooth work flow and respect for deadlines for projects.

Record each experience in reverse chronological order, starting with the most recent position.

5. Education

This section should list your education and experience related to carpentry. In this section, include the name of the institution, the degree or diploma you earned (if relevant) and the date of your completion.

Example:

Diploma in Carpentry – XYZ Technical Institute | May 2012

6. Certifications and Training

If you’ve attended specific training courses or obtained certifications directly related to carpentry. List the details at the bottom of this list. This will prove your commitment in professional growth and continuing education within the field.

Example:

OSHA Certified: Completed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) training course on safety procedures for construction.

FAQs

What can I do to create an impressive resume for a job as a carpenter job?

A successful resume for a position as a carpenter requires attention to detail and highlight relevant skills and experience. Here are some tips to help you design an outstanding carpenter’s resume

  1. Make the content more specific Your resume can be customized to match the requirements of the position the job you’re seeking. Highlight your relevant experience in addition to your qualifications, skills, and experience.
  2. Add a professional overview Make a short summary at the beginning of your resume to introduce yourself and grab the attention of prospective employers. You should focus on showcasing your most important advantages as a woodworker.
  3. Highlight your technical abilities: Emphasize your proficiency in the use of carpentry tools as well as equipment and techniques. Include key words related to the different kinds of carpentry jobs you’ve done (e.g., framing, finish, woodworking).
  4. Display previous projects Include sections that highlight notable projects or achievements in your profession as carpenter. Define the scope of the project, the specifics of your role and any measurable outcomes or outcomes.
  5. Include any certifications or training In the event that you’ve been awarded any certifications or education related to carpentry, be certain to mention them. This could include safety certifications or specialized training programs or apprenticeships.

What format should I utilize for my carpenter resume?

When it comes to choosing a format for your carpenter resume, it’s important to keep it clean, professional-looking, and easy-to-read for hiring managers. Here are two common styles that are suitable for resumes:

  1. The Chronological Format This format highlights your professional background by presenting it in reverse chronological order (starting with your most recent work). It is ideal if you have solid experience as a carpenter and would like to emphasize an ongoing career advancement.
  2. Functional formats The format is focused on your abilities and experience, rather than focusing on particular dates or job names. It’s ideal for those who have transferable abilities, are changing careers, or have gaps in your employment history.

Pick the format that best fits your particular situation. You should also ensure that your resume is consistent across all sections. You could also think about using an amalgamation of both formats to effectively showcase your experience and knowledge in carpentry.

How can I make my Carpenter resume stand out?

To make your resume for a carpenter stand out among the others be sure to follow these suggestions:

  1. Quantify achievements If you can you can include specific numbers, percents, or measurements to highlight your achievements as a carpenter. For example, write down the number of construction projects you have successfully completed or quantify the cost savings realized through your work.
  2. Use action verbs Start bullet points describing the previous tasks with action verbs that increase their impact and make them more interesting and powerful. Verbs such as "built, " "installed, " "created, " and "managed" demonstrate initiative and confidence.
  3. Incorporate industry terms Create a customized resume by including relevant industry keywords relevant to the field of carpentry. Scan job descriptions for common phrases or terms and use them on your resume if it is appropriate. This will attract employers’ attention or application tracking software (ATS).
  4. Include your portfolio: If possible include a URL or mention that you have a portfolio showcasing photos of your previous projects in carpentry, or descriptions of your most notable projects. The visual evidence will help show the quality of your craftsmanship.
  5. Be sure to proofread it carefully Make sure you eliminate any grammar or spelling mistakes from your resume by proofreading it several times. Unfortunate mistakes can make a negative impression on prospective employers, and can reduce the quality of a resume that is otherwise well-written.

Should I include references on my resume for carpenter?

The inclusion of references on a resume is no longer considered mandatory or a standard method. Instead, use the space on your resume for other information pertinent to your job.

But, it’s a great idea to have a separate list of professional references you are able to present to employers upon demand. You should ensure that your references are individuals who can speak about your skills, quality of work, and your qualifications as carpenter. Incorporate their full names as well as job titles along with contact information and an explanation of how you work with them (e.g. Former supervisor or employee).

When you list references, be sure to inform your contacts beforehand and make sure they’re willing to act as references for you. In addition, you should keep your references list current in the event of any changes.
